Great! I suppose you passed the medical exam, or haven't yet (they suggest applying at least one week after taking the upfront medical test).
Once the background check is completed, they will start the eligibility review process which should be quick.
Also keep in mind that the online tracking system is having issues lately, you may see inconsistent or no updates before you get the final decision. It's best to wait 20 days after your biometrics date (I am talking SDS processing time here), then if you don't receive any updates only then you should worry.
